Output 18ef5e5715fe0a07d7aee6d613b91104d121b7f0c69a43d40eaa3850dec38d7a:0

value
1049216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d157e0af6b95f55496605bb71b492c71c199619 OP_EQUAL
address
3D6Q8qXm7KKzE8ZLNtbZiXxPPmBbyLMhia
transaction
18ef5e5715fe0a07d7aee6d613b91104d121b7f0c69a43d40eaa3850dec38d7a
confirmations
307727
spent
true